M. Schrödl, S. Ojak:
"Design of a remote controlled valve for fluid control based on the DUOMOTORŪ principle";
Talk: ISEF 2003, Maribor, Slovenia; 09-18-2003 - 09-20-2003; in: "ISEF 2003 - 11th International Symposium on Electromagnetic Fields in Electrical Engineering", (2003), 6 pages.



English abstract:
In this paper a design for a remote controlled valve for fluid control is presented. It is based on the DUOMOTORŪ-principle. In the introduction a short description of the mechanical design of the machine is given. Also the electrical principle is explained. Further more the control structure is presented. The goal is to control the machine without mechanical sensor. The calculation of the rotor positions with help of the voltage model is shown. At the end measurement-results are given to show the usability of the presented method.
